使用者需要按照時間區間將資料進行分組指派。
範例一:日期在2015-10-26以前命名為「累計新增」,之後的時間命名為「大於」,如下圖所示:
範例二:不同時間段按照「0點-6點」、「6點-12點」、「12點-18點」、「18點-24點」分組,並根據不同區間統計個數,如下圖所示:
範例一:使用 IF 函式進行條件判斷指派;使用 DATESUBDATE 函式計算時間差;
範例二:使用 MID 函式提取時間段,使用「新增列>分組指派」進行時間區間分組,並進行組內求和計數。
建立自助資料集,選擇「銷售DEMO>地區資料分析」下的所有欄位,如下圖所示:
新增新增列步驟,命名為「時間段分組」,輸入公式:IF(DATESUBDATE(合同簽約時間,"2015-10-26","s")>0,"累計新僧","大於"),點選「確定」,如下圖所示:
注1:當做日期相加減的時候,不能直接使用「-」,需要使用 DATESUBDATE 函式進行時間差計算。
注2:公式框中的函式、欄位都需要點選左側的選擇區域選擇,不能手動輸入。
公式說明:
以秒為單位傳回合同簽約時間與 2015-10-26 的時間差
合同簽約時間 - 2015-10-26
命名並儲存自助資料集。
詳情參見本文 1.1 節範例一。
範例資料:時間區間分組.xlsx
將下載的範例資料上傳至 FineBI 中,如下圖所示:
建立自助資料集並選擇「時間區間分組」下的所有欄位,如下圖所示:
建立「新增列」,命名為「取時間段」,輸入公式:MID(日期,12,2)(函式用法可參見:MID-傳回指定位置字串)
如此便可提取出日期欄位中的“小時”,如下圖所示:
建立「新增列」,命名為「按時間區間分組」,選擇「分組賦值」,並將提取好的欄位進行分組,點選「確定」,如下圖所示:
若想知道每個時間段中時間的個數,可以新增列「時間分佈情況」,如下圖所示:
3.5 效果查看
詳情參見本文 1.1 節範例二。